Gujarat: Over 1 lakh cops deployed to enforce COVID-19 rules, says DGP

At least 56,000 police personnel, 5,000 staffers of the State Reserve Police (SRP), over 13,000 home guards and 30,000 jawans of the Gram Rakshak Dal (GRD) have been deployed across the state

AHMEDABAD, MAY 12

More than 1 lakh police personnel have been deployed across Gujarat to ensure strict enforcement of COVID-19 guidelines in light of the recent rise in infections, an official said on Wednesday.

At least 56,000 police personnel, 5,000 staffers of the State Reserve Police (SRP), over 13,000 home guards and 30,000 jawans of the Gram Rakshak Dal (GRD) have been deployed across the state, the official said.

The Gujarat government on Tuesday extended the night curfew and other day-time restrictions in 36 cities by another week, in order to contain the viral spread.

Following the announcement, Gujarat Director General of Police (DGP) Ashish Bhatia on Tuesday held a virtual meeting with senior police officers and directed them to strictly enforce the rules and guidelines issued by the state government, a release stated.

All police officers have been directed to ensure that people in their respective areas wear masks, maintain social distancing and follow all the COVID-19-related standard operating procedures, it was stated.

According to the release, the police have been asked to stop any public celebration of upcoming festivals, mainly Eid and Lord Parshuram Jayanti.

Officers have also been directed to keep a check on weddings and ensure that not more than 50 persons are present at venues, it said.

The police have so far registered 514 cases and arrested 666 persons for violating wedding-related notification that prohibits gatherings of more than 50 persons, the official said.

On May 10 alone, the state police registered 2,445 cases related to different violations and arrested 2,423 people, he said.

Apart from this, over 10,000 people were fined for mask violation and for spitting in public, he added.

Police book 125, arrest 15 for religious procession amid pandemic

Police on Wednesday registered an FIR against around 125 people for allegedly flouting COVID-19 guidelines after they took out a religious procession at Palodiya village in Gandhinagar district of Gujarat, an official said.

So far, 15 people have been arrested in connection with the incident that took place around 10 am on Tuesday in Kalol tehsil, Deputy Superintendent of Police (Kalol division), V N Solanki, said.

Around 125 men and women had taken part in the procession to offer prayers, he said.

“Despite creating awareness among rural people against holding such prayers during the COVID-19 pandemic and despite the instructions to sarpanchs (village heads) to inform the police about such gatherings, these people assembled at one place in a large numbers,” Solanki said.

The FIR against those who took part in the procession was registered at Santej police station on Wednsday. While 35 of the participants have been identified, the remaining ones are yet to be identified, he said.

They were booked under IPC sections 188 (disobedience to order duly promulgated by public servant), 269 (act likely to spread the infection of any disease dangerous to life), and provisions of the Epidemic Diseases Act, he said.

“We have arrested 15 of these accused persons, and the video footage of the event is being scanned. Soon, we will identify and arrest all of them,” Solanki said.
